Transaction d9b5801062c34c944084da76622f46a1b5ec16a3cf7d156e95a10dff6e316513
1 Input
1 Output
-
d9b5801062c34c944084da76622f46a1b5ec16a3cf7d156e95a10dff6e316513:0
- value
- 5031142
- script pubkey
- OP_0 OP_PUSHBYTES_20 12faf83d83a2c0def243ef45dee44f36cc2d6776
- address
- bc1qzta0s0vr5tqdaujraazaaez0xmxz6emkncauk2